Why “01” Might Signal a Red Flag—Not a Launchpad

Many assume “01” implies a flagship or primary platform. In reality, it’s frequently used by unlicensed offshore operators mimicking legitimacy. The UK Gambling Commission maintains a public register of licensed operators—yet dozens of sites branded with numeric suffixes like “01,” “02,” or “UK1” operate from Curacao, Malta (without MGA consumer licenses), or even unknown jurisdictions.

These platforms exploit SEO tactics:
- Registering domains like onlinecasino01.co.uk (note: .co.uk ≠ UKGC license)
- Using “UK” in meta titles despite zero regulatory presence
- Displaying fake “GamCare” or “BeGambleAware” badges without partnership

Always verify via the UKGC License Checker. If a site lacks a 5-digit UKGC number in its footer, walk away—regardless of bonus size.

What Others Won’t Tell You: The Fine Print That Costs Real Money

Most guides gloss over operational risks that hit your bank balance. Here’s what “online casino 01” newcomers rarely anticipate:

KYC Delays Aren’t Just Bureaucracy—They’re Profit Barriers
You win £500 on your first spin. Great! But if you haven’t pre-submitted ID, the casino can legally withhold funds until verification completes. UKGC rules permit this—but some “01” sites stretch timelines to 14+ days, hoping you’ll chase losses while waiting. Pro tip: Upload passport + utility bill before your first deposit.

Bonus Wagering Multipliers Hide Effective RTP Drops
A “100% up to £100” offer sounds generous. But if it carries 50x wagering on slots with 95% RTP, your effective return plummets:

In practice, you’d need to bet £5,000 (£100 x 50) to withdraw winnings—statistically losing £250 before cashout. Always check game contribution rates; some slots count 10%, others 0%.

Payment Method Switching Triggers Anti-Fraud Locks
Depositing via PayPal but withdrawing to a bank card? Many “01” casinos auto-flag this as “suspicious activity,” freezing accounts for “security review.” UKGC mandates same-method withdrawals where possible—yet offshore clones ignore this, citing vague “AML policies.”

RNG Certification Gaps Mean Unaudited Outcomes
Legit UK casinos display eCOGRA or iTech Labs seals proving fair RNGs. “Online casino 01” clones often omit these—or link to expired certificates. Without third-party audits, there’s no proof your “near-miss” wasn’t algorithmically engineered.

The Bonus Trap: When “Free Spins” Become Financial Anchors

New players flock to “online casino 01” for sign-up deals. But consider this real-case scenario from a UK player (January 2026):

“I claimed 50 free spins on Book of Dead. Won £85. Withdrawal denied because I hadn’t wagered the bonus 40x. The T&Cs were buried in a PDF linked from the FAQ—not the promo page.”

UKGC requires bonus terms to be “clear, prominent, and easily accessible.” Many “01” sites violate this by:
- Using 8pt font for wagering requirements
- Hiding max cashout limits (£50 is common)
- Excluding popular games (e.g., “Mega Moolah ineligible”)

Always screenshot bonus terms before accepting. If it’s not visible during signup, it’s likely non-compliant.

Responsible Gambling Isn’t Optional—It’s Your Legal Right

Under UK law, licensed casinos must offer:
- Deposit limits (daily/weekly/monthly)
- Session time reminders
- Reality checks every 60 minutes
- Direct links to GamCare (0808 8020 133)

“Online casino 01” clones often lack these. Worse, some disable timeout features entirely—encouraging marathon sessions. If a site doesn’t prompt you after 30 minutes of continuous play, it’s operating outside UK standards.
